  • Develop and provide excellent customer service to internal and external customers at all times.
  • Execute various manual labor functions such as picking inventory, counting cargo, and staging/loading goods.
  • Coordinate receipt, storage, and distribution of materials, tools, equipment, and products within assigned area.
  • Manage sorting and placement of materials or items on racks, shelves, pallets, or in bins according to predetermined sequence.
  • Potential opportunity to serve as a lead operator in less complex, smaller teams or standard operations.
  • Assist with training and providing basic work instructions to new hires or transfers.
  • Operate a forklift when required and is fully trained and operational.
  • Complete or verify appropriate forms, documents, labels, and other information to ensure the accuracy of inventory.
  • Identify potential operational or service concerns and assist with resolving.
  • Monitor various warehouse maintenance tasks.
  • High School Diploma or GED.
  • Typically at least two years of warehousing or related logistics experience, or successful completion of a rotation program.
  • Forklift Certification typically required in most operations within 3 to 6 months of hire.
  • Valid state issued driver's license preferred.
  • Ability to operate hand and power tools, including hand truck, pallet jack, and related warehouse equipment.
  • Basic proficiency in Internet, web-based and job specific software applications.
  • Ability to become forklift certified, when required.
  • Ability to read, comprehend and complete basic checklists, forms or other related documents.
